About the Hotel

With a location steps from Waikiki Beach, ‘Alohilani Resort sits where the city meets the sand with a sophisticated awe-inspiring design that pays homage to Hawaii’s rich cultural heritage. This resort is a modern oasis that offers a refreshing balance of energy and relaxation. Experience the open-air lobby and captivating 280,000 gallon Oceanarium unique to Honolulu resorts. The destination pool deck with private cabanas offers a saltwater infinity pool, and a pool bar that seamlessly transitions from day to night.

At ʻAlohilani Resort Waikiki Beach, we are dedicated to preserving Hawaii’s delicate eco-system by exploring and implementing on-property initiatives to support the sustainability of our beautiful state and the resort is the only carbon neutral hotel in the State of Hawaii. ‘Alohilani is a modern oasis that offers a refreshing balance of energy and relaxation in a lively, urban location.

I was disappointed with my experience at Alohilani, primarily due to the condition of my room. I stayed on the 9th floor, where the bathroom was uncomfortably small and featured only a half shower screen, making it difficult to shower without soaking the floor. Upon arriving, I immediately noticed that the floors in both the bedroom and bathroom were dirty, and I had to call housekeeping to vacuum. It also appeared that fresh sheets had not been placed on the bed. Alohilani did replace all bedding and apologized for the inconvenience. Overall, it seemed that ʻAlohilani prioritizes its common areas and amenities over the quality and upkeep of its guest rooms. I also ordered a slice of pizza to-go from one of their restaurants, and it was served on a paper plate wrapped in foil—disappointing given the hotel’s high prices. That said, my cousin stayed in an upgraded room and had a wonderful experience. If you choose to stay at ʻAlohilani, I highly recommend securing an upgraded room to get the most out of your stay.
